MADRID (AP) — Real Betis was frustrated in its pursuit of a European place in the Spanish league after a 1-1 draw at home against Sevilla in the Seville derby on Sunday.
Betis went ahead with a goal by Isco in the 38th minute but Kike Salas equalized for the visitors in the 56th, leaving Betis two points from sixth-place Real Sociedad in the final Europa Conference League spot.
Fifth-place Athletic Bilbao was nine points ahead of Betis in the final Europa League qualification place.
Sevilla stayed in 13th but opened a 12-point gap to the relegation zone with five rounds to go.
Betis was awarded a penalty kick shortly after Sevilla equalized, but the call was reversed with the help of video review.
Isco’s penalty kick came after a controversial handball.
Betis was coming off two straight victories — against Celta Vigo and at Valencia — after a run of four straight losses. Sevilla had won three in a row.
